Output 42048943f105a55344d80efb850938670e504ac8fd20d821e4d72073e349a40a:90

value
5547685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e2ee6c3635951ec4ae8742d0b2a107a512657f OP_EQUAL
address
31xH8Pm995Wk7QUg9K2yg139BbZpH7Um3C
transaction
42048943f105a55344d80efb850938670e504ac8fd20d821e4d72073e349a40a
confirmations
262235
spent
true